Overview

The Drick DRK-TGL16E is a precision-engineered benchtop high-speed centrifuge designed for routine and research-grade separation tasks in agricultural science, environmental monitoring, and life science laboratories. It operates on the principle of sedimentation under controlled rotational acceleration, enabling rapid phase separation of heterogeneous liquid samples based on particle density, size, and shape. With a maximum rotational speed of 16,000 rpm and a corresponding maximum relative centrifugal force (RCF) of 19,040 × g, the DRK-TGL16E delivers reproducible performance across a wide range of sample volumes (0.2–100 mL per tube) and rotor configurations. Its compact footprint (480 × 480 × 275 mm) allows seamless integration into space-constrained analytical workstations while maintaining structural rigidity and thermal stability during extended operation.

Key Features

  • Brushless DC motor with microprocessor-controlled speed regulation ensures long service life, minimal vibration, and precise speed accuracy (±10 rpm at 16,000 rpm).
  • Intelligent rotor recognition system prevents mismatched rotor operation and enforces safe speed limits per rotor geometry.
  • Double-layer stainless-steel chamber with reinforced aluminum rotor housing provides corrosion resistance and mechanical integrity for repeated use with organic solvents and aqueous buffers.
  • Digital control panel with real-time display of rpm, RCF, time remaining, and temperature (optional cooling version available upon request).
  • Programmable ramp-up/ramp-down profiles support gentle pelleting of sensitive biological aggregates or rapid decanting of dense particulates.
  • Automatic lid lock with dual-safety interlock meets IEC 61010-2-020 requirements for laboratory centrifuge safety.

Sample Compatibility & Compliance

The DRK-TGL16E accommodates standard conical-bottom polypropylene and polycarbonate tubes (e.g., 1.5 mL, 5 mL, 15 mL, and 50 mL formats) as well as custom-angle rotors for specialized applications such as soil suspension fractionation or wastewater sludge dewatering. Its fixed-angle rotor design optimizes pelleting efficiency for particles >10 nm in diameter—ideal for extracting microbial biomass from rhizosphere soils, concentrating suspended solids in surface water samples, or isolating extracellular vesicles from plant tissue homogenates. The instrument conforms to essential electrical safety standards (IEC 61010-1) and supports laboratory quality systems aligned with ISO/IEC 17025:2017 clause 6.4 (equipment validation). While not intrinsically refrigerated, its ambient-temperature operation has been validated for stability over continuous 90-minute runs at ≥14,000 rpm, meeting typical throughput demands in agronomic and ecotoxicological workflows.

Software & Data Management

The DRK-TGL16E features an RS-232 serial interface for integration with laboratory information management systems (LIMS) or third-party data acquisition platforms. Protocol parameters—including speed setpoint, run duration, acceleration/deceleration rate, and start timestamp—are logged locally and exportable as CSV files for audit trail generation. When deployed in GLP or GMP-regulated environments, users may configure external software to capture full operational metadata, satisfying traceability requirements under FDA 21 CFR Part 11 (electronic records and signatures) when paired with appropriate access controls and audit log retention policies. Firmware updates are delivered via secure USB-based protocol to ensure continued compliance with evolving cybersecurity best practices for scientific instrumentation.

Applications

  • Agricultural science: Separation of root exudates, fungal spore suspensions, and pesticide residue extracts from soil leachates.
  • Environmental analysis: Concentration of microplastics, algae cells, and heavy metal-bound colloids from riverine and wastewater influent samples.
  • Plant biochemistry: Isolation of chloroplasts, mitochondria, and cell wall polysaccharide fractions from leaf and stem homogenates.
  • Microbial ecology: Pelleting of bacterial consortia from compost leachate or anaerobic digester effluent prior to DNA extraction.
  • Quality control labs: Routine clarification of nutrient media, enzyme solutions, and seed treatment formulations prior to spectrophotometric or HPLC analysis.

FAQ

Is the DRK-TGL16E certified for use in ISO/IEC 17025-accredited laboratories?
Yes—the device includes calibration documentation, traceable speed verification procedures, and mechanical validation reports suitable for inclusion in equipment qualification protocols.
Can it be used with refrigerated rotors or integrated cooling?
The base model operates at ambient temperature; however, optional Peltier-cooled variants (DRK-TGL16E-C) are available for temperature-sensitive separations down to 4 °C.
What rotor configurations are supported out-of-the-box?
Standard delivery includes a 12-place fixed-angle rotor compatible with 1.5–50 mL tubes; additional rotors (e.g., 24-place microtube, PCR strip-compatible) are available as accessories.
Does the centrifuge support timed stop or automatic brake release?
Yes—it offers programmable run time (1 s to 99 min 59 s), soft-brake mode to minimize resuspension, and audible end-of-run alert.
How is maintenance performed and what is the recommended service interval?
Routine cleaning and visual inspection are required after each use; full preventive maintenance—including bearing assessment and torque calibration—is advised every 12 months or after 1,000 operating hours, whichever occurs first.
